Premier Pump & Power is a family-owned manufacturer of industrial pumps and energy solutions. We specialize in large, custom, portable pump packages, and our products are renowned for their performance, serviceability and built-in quality. We proudly serve thousands of customers from our global headquarters in Vancouver, Washington and our new manufacturing factory in Houston, Texas.
At Premier you will work on all aspects of pump and industrial manufacturing as part of a mechanical team consisting of entry-level, mid-level and senior mechanics. You will learn every aspect of chassis, engine and industrial assembly, contributing and building your mechanical skills. You will prepare with appropriate tools and safety equipment, take instructions and be a team player.
You will report to the Assembly Supervisor

Accommodation
Employees must be able to lift and move up to 10 pounds, and occasionally lift and move up to 50 pounds. Close vision is required for this job. While performing the responsibilities of this job, employees are required to speak and understand English, stand and sit, and use their fingers and thumbs. Employees are frequently required to reach with their hands and arms and are occasionally required to kneel or stoop.
While working in the factory, performing inspections and troubleshooting equipment, employees may be asked to work under varying weather conditions, operate heavy machinery and tolerate moderate noise levels.
